Blackwell's Bookshop, also known as Blackwell's, is a British academic book retailer and library supply service that was founded in 1879 by Benjamin Henry Blackwell. With 18 shops across the UK, Blackwell's offers a wide range of books and maps. The company has a rich history of promoting universal access to literature and has been a launching pad for many writers, including J.R.R. Tolkien. In 2022, Blackwell's was acquired by Waterstones, marking a new chapter in its long-standing legacy in the world of bookselling.
